This Penguin 60 is a collection of excerpts taken from his autobiography Speak, Easy.
As a collection of excerpts, it is somewhat fragmented, and while one excerpt may be interesting or poignant the next can be not only not relevant, but less interesting - depending on the reader of course.
I found the writing in places was very good, and in the excepts (or parts of excerpts, when it came to butterflies) I found interesting I was captivated enough, but there were far fewer things I was interested in, and skimming - yes, even in a book only 58 pages long.
3 stars from me.
